Typical Lifespan of a Boiler

Boilers, normally, have a life-span around 15 years. The longevity of the boiler largely depends upon factors such as for example maintenance, utilization patterns, and the sort of boiler set up.

There are various boiler types available, including combi boilers, system boilers, and conventional boilers, each with its own set of advantages and efficiency levels.

Combi boilers, for instance, are recognized for their space-saving style and high heating efficiency. They offer hot water on demand, making them popular for smaller sized homes.

System boilers add a warm water cylinder, guaranteeing a quicker response to multiple warm water taps being utilized simultaneously.

Typical boilers, also known as heat-only boilers, are often found in old properties and work alongside a cold-water tank.

To maximize the life expectancy of your boiler, regular maintenance is vital. This consists of annual servicing, bleeding radiators, and confirming appropriate insulation.

Signs of a Failing Boiler

Experiencing issues with your boiler can be concerning, particularly if you depend on it for heating system your home or business. Spotting the indicators of a failing boiler in early stages can help prevent unpredicted breakdowns.

One common indicator is normally unusual noises from the boiler, such as for example banging, whistling, or gurgling sounds. These sounds could signal problems like mineral buildup, air in the system, or impending element failure.

Another critical sign to view for may be the pilot light. If the pilot light frequently goes out or adjustments color from blue to yellowish, it may indicate a problem with the gas combination or ventilation. Additionally, a pilot light that flickers or appears weak could be a sign of inadequate gas circulation or a malfunctioning thermocouple.

If you notice any of these symptoms, it's advisable to contact a professional specialist to inspect and address the underlying problems promptly. Regular maintenance may also assist in preventing these problems and warranty your boiler operates effectively.

DIY Care Ideas

To maintain excellent performance and extend the life-span of your boiler, implementing DIY care tips is key.

By subsequent these easy steps, you can guarantee your boiler operates efficiently and effectively for years to come.

Four essential DIY care tips for your boiler include:

  1. Frequently clean the boiler: Dust and debris can accumulate, impacting its efficiency. Wipe down the exterior and remove any build-up in the unit.
  2. Examine for leaks: Inspect the boiler for just about any symptoms of leakage, such as for example water pooling around the unit. Addressing leaks promptly can prevent further harm and improve energy effectiveness.
  3. Bleed the radiators: In case your radiators aren't warming up properly, they may need bleeding to release caught air. This simple task can boost the overall efficiency of your heating system.
  4. Monitor boiler pressure: Monitor the boiler pressure measure and verify it remains within the perfect range. Low or high pressure can result in issues with heating system and hot water supply, needing boiler troubleshooting.

Eco-Friendly Boiler Options

When looking to replace your boiler, exploring eco-friendly options can't just benefit the surroundings but also potentially save money in the long run.

One popular eco-friendly choice is condensing boilers. These boilers are highly effective as they catch and reuse warmth that would otherwise be lost in traditional boilers. By reusing this heat, condensing boilers can help reduce energy consumption and decrease your bills.

Another eco-friendly option to explore is utilizing renewable energy resources to power your boiler. Alternative energy sources such as for example solar power or biomass can be built-into your heat to lower your carbon footprint and reliance on nonrenewable resources.
